Agent Rules (read before doing anything else)

The SQLite database is an internal implementation detail, not the API. The ttrpg-engine binary is the sole interface to canonical state.

Agents MUST:

  • Use ttrpg-engine subcommands for all reads and writes
  • Call campaign get-story-state --json to load world state
  • Treat the .db file as opaque — back it up, copy it, but never open it for writes
  • Let the binary run schema migrations automatically on startup

Agents MUST NOT:

  • Run sqlite3 against the campaign database for any reason
  • Execute CREATE, ALTER, DROP, INSERT, UPDATE, or DELETE against the .db
  • Infer schema from docs/schema.md and write rows directly
  • Patch, repair, or migrate the database manually

Why. The binary manages schema versioning with PRAGMA user_version and forward-only migrations. Any external DDL or DML breaks version tracking, corrupts the migration chain, and produces errors the agent cannot diagnose. The .db file is safe to read with any SQLite browser for inspection — just never write to it.

The World Engine

ttrpg-engine models your tabletop world as a relational database — every tavern, blacksmith, quest giver, and goblin camp is a row you can query, update, and connect. It was built for DMs who run long-form campaigns with deep continuity, and for AI agents that need a canonical source of truth about the game state.

The world model. You create a campaign. Inside it, you build locations — towns, districts, dungeons. Locations nest into sub-locations (Ashwick > Blacksmith District > The Anvil & Flame). Each location holds houses (with residents and inventory), shops (with opening hours and proprietors), wandering encounters, and story-driving setpieces. NPCs, characters, and creatures all have a location — the CLI tells you exactly who is where right now.

The memory system. A stateless AI agent only knows what you tell it. ttrpg-engine solves this with three systems working together: a campaign journal (timestamped session recaps the AI writes and reads back), a quest tracker (step-by-step objectives with linked actors, so the AI remembers what the party is supposed to be doing), and an in-game calendar (day, time of day, season) so the AI can say "it's autumn evening on day 42." One command — campaign get-story-state — returns the complete context packet the AI needs to reconstruct the game from a cold start.

The combat engine. Turn-based 5e-compatible combat lives inside the database. combat start, combat join, combat init set up the encounter. combat attack resolves attack rolls against AC. combat damage applies damage with automatic resistance/vulnerability/immunity. combat save handles saving throws with proficiency bonuses. combat next advances turns, resets reactions each round. Death saves, concentration, conditions, reactions, and ready actions are all tracked. The combat snapshot appears in get-story-state — the AI always knows who's up, what HP everyone has, and what conditions are active.

The relationship graph. NPCs have friendships, rivalries, and family ties with each other (tracked with a decay-aware score). Characters have personal faction standings, and campaigns track party-wide institutional faction reputation — a faction can hate one PC but still mark the party as hostile for the group's actions. Houses have residents. Characters group into parties with shared treasury and location. Quests have quest givers and participants. Every entity can be linked to every other entity — the database IS the campaign bible.

Built for AI pipelines. Every command emits --json output for piping into LLM agents, Discord bots, or automation scripts. The schema is designed so an AI can call get-story-state, receive the full world snapshot (locations tree with all entities present, active quests, recent journal entries, faction standings, story log), and immediately begin DMing with full context. No warm-up, no context-stuffing — one query, everything it needs.

Fast by design. Single-row lookups are O(1) via indexed primary keys. List commands scale with result size, not table size. Location tree walks are O(depth) with depth bounded by campaign geography (practically ≤10). Arena-based memory with zero heap allocations after startup. Automatic SQLite schema migrations — drop the binary into a campaign folder and run. No config files, no daemons, no network calls. Just a 2.6 MB binary and a .db file you can commit to git alongside your session notes.

Stable ID contract

  • Every entity has an integer primary key (id). IDs are SQLite INTEGER PRIMARY KEY — never reused after DELETE.
  • Actor references are (actor_type, actor_id) tuples. actor_type is one of "character", "npc", or "creature". These strings are stable and will not change.
  • Location IDs are global, not per-campaign. A location's parent_id points to another location by its global ID.
  • Faction IDs are global. Characters, NPCs, wanted heat, and standings all reference factions by these IDs.
  • Campaign IDs scope characters, NPCs, locations, quests, and journal entries. An entity's campaign_id links it to the campaign it belongs to.
  • Name fields are display-only. Never key logic off name — always use id. Names can change, be duplicated, or be empty.

Exit codes and error shapes

Every command returns 0 on success, 1 on failure. All output goes to stdout in JSON mode; errors go to stderr in text mode.

Success shape (varies by command, but always contains "success":true):

{"success":true, "message": "...", ...command-specific fields...}

Error shape (uniform across all commands):

{
  "success": false,
  "code": "MACHINE_READABLE_CODE",
  "error": "Human-readable message. Tells the agent what went wrong and what to do next.",
  "retryable": false
}

code is a stable, machine-readable identifier. Branch on it. Never branch on the error string — that field is for human debugging and may change wording. Codes follow <DOMAIN>_<SPECIFIC_STATE> in SCREAMING_SNAKE_CASE.

error is a prompt-shaped message. It tells the agent what went wrong and what command to call or what argument to fix. Treat it as system context for the next agent turn.

retryable is a boolean hint. true means the operation might succeed if retried (database lock, transient state). false means the operation failed for a reason that retrying won't fix (bad input, missing entity).

Code When Retryable
USAGE Missing or invalid arguments No
NOT_FOUND Entity ID doesn't exist No
VALIDATION Argument passed but value is out of range or wrong shape No
CONFLICT Uniqueness constraint violated No
DB_ERROR Database operation failed (lock, I/O) Yes
INTERNAL Catch-all for unexpected failures No
COMBAT_ALREADY_ACTIVE Tried to start combat when an encounter is already running No
REST_BLOCKED_BY_COMBAT Tried to rest while combat is active No
SPELL_SLOT_EXHAUSTED No spell slots remaining at the requested level No
CHARACTER_DEAD Cannot act — HP is 0 No
INVENTORY_QUANTITY_INVALID Quantity must be positive No
SHOP_OUT_OF_STOCK Shop has insufficient stock No
SHOP_HAGGLE_EXHAUSTED No haggle attempts remaining today No
TIME_INVALID Calendar input is out of valid range No

This list grows over time. Treat unknown codes as INTERNAL and fall back to the error message. The current full taxonomy is defined in cmd/errors.odin.

Concurrency and locking

SQLite provides serialized write access. The binary opens a single connection to ttrpg-engine.db per invocation and closes it before exiting. Two concurrent processes:

  • Reads never block each other. Multiple get-story-state or list calls can run in parallel.
  • Writes serialize via SQLite's internal lock. If process A is mid-write, process B's write blocks until A commits. If the wait exceeds SQLite's busy timeout, B gets {"success":false,"error":"Failed to ..."} and exits 1.
  • There is no WAL mode. The database uses SQLite's default rollback journal. Long-running reads can starve writers under extreme load.

Recommendation for agents: serialize all writes through a single process or queue. Reads can fan out freely. If you need to batch mutations, chain them in a single ttrpg-engine invocation by using multiple subcommands (not yet supported — each invocation is one command).

Database portability

The campaign database is a single SQLite file (ttrpg-engine.db). This means:

  • Backup is cp. Copy the file. That's it.
  • Clone a campaign by copying the .db and renaming the campaign row.
  • Version control the .db alongside your session notes. SQLite files diff reasonably with sqldiff or git diff after sqlite3 .db .dump > schema.sql.
  • Cross-platform. The .db file is binary-identical across macOS and Linux. Copy it between machines freely.
  • Inspect with any SQLite tool. sqlite3, DB Browser, Datasette — the schema is documented in docs/schema.md. Reads are always safe; never issue DDL (see schema warning above).

Code quality constraints

Every proc in the codebase has a hard cyclomatic complexity limit of 10 (McCabe's original threshold). Decision points counted: if, else if, for, case (in switch), &&, ||, ?:. Procs that would exceed the limit must be split — helper procs that exist only to keep a caller under the limit are preferred over clever monolithic functions. This keeps every unit of logic reviewable in a single screen of code.

Dice Notation

All damage, healing, attack rolls, saving throws, initiative, and hit dice values accept dice specs instead of plain integers. The engine rolls cryptographically secure random numbers internally.

Format: [count]d<sides>[+modifier] with optional suffixes:

Example Meaning
d20 Roll 1d20
2d6+3 Roll 2d6, add 3
8d6 Roll 8d6 (Fireball)
4d8+5 Roll 4d8, add 5
d20+5 Roll 1d20, add 5
1d20+3 Roll initiative (d20 + DEX mod)
4d6k3 Roll 4d6, keep highest 3
4d6d1 Roll 4d6, drop lowest 1
3d6! Roll 3d6, exploding (reroll on max)
2d20r1 Roll 2d20, reroll 1s
5d10t8 Roll 5d10, count successes ≥ 8
4dF Roll 4 Fudge dice

Every command that previously accepted a raw integer now accepts a dice spec. The engine parses the spec, rolls with cryptographically secure RNG, and uses the total.

16. Shop & Economy

Browse shop inventory, stock items with custom prices, buy and sell with full currency exchange. Shops have their own treasuries — they gain coins when characters buy and lose coins when they buy items back. Linked to an owner NPC via npc_id.

Shop scale (low, mid, high, luxury) controls three mechanics automatically:

Scale Auto-treasury Buyback rate Max item value
low 50 gp 30% 50 gp
mid 500 gp 50% 500 gp
high 2,000 gp 60% 5,000 gp
luxury 10,000 gp 70% no limit

The DM can override the auto-treasury with shop add-money / shop remove-money at any time.

  • Browse Shop Inventory:

    ./ttrpg-engine shop browse <shop_id> [--json]

    Lists all items in stock with quantities and per-unit prices. Price shows the shop’s custom price if set, otherwise the item’s base value_gp.

  • Stock Items (DM):

    ./ttrpg-engine shop stock <shop_id> <item_id> <quantity> [price_gp]

    Add or replace item stock in a shop. If price_gp is omitted or 0, the item’s base value_gp is used.

  • Purchase from Shop:

    ./ttrpg-engine shop buy <shop_id> <char_id> <item_id> <quantity> [--json]

    Character buys items. Auto-deducts coins from character (pp→gp→ep→sp→cp, largest first), credits shop treasury. Enforces the shop's max item value by scale. Validates sufficient stock and funds. Returns exit code 1 on failure.

  • Sell to Shop:

    ./ttrpg-engine shop sell <shop_id> <char_id> <item_id> <quantity> [--json]

    Character sells items at the shop's scale-based buyback rate (30%–70% of base value_gp). Shop pays from its treasury — if the shop can’t afford the buyback, the sale is rejected with exit code 1. Removed from character inventory, restocked in shop.

  • Manage Shop Treasury (DM):

    ./ttrpg-engine shop add-money <shop_id> <gold> <silver> <copper> [platinum] [electrum]
    ./ttrpg-engine shop remove-money <shop_id> <gold> <silver> <copper> [platinum] [electrum]

    Seed or drain a shop’s operating funds. Multi-denomination — the engine converts and distributes across coin types automatically.

  • View Shop Details:

    ./ttrpg-engine shop get <shop_id> [--json]

    Displays shop name, location, scale, open hours, proprietor NPC, and current treasury breakdown.

  • Haggle for a Discount:

    ./ttrpg-engine shop haggle <shop_id> <char_id> <item_id> <quantity> <discount_pct> [--json]

    Attempt a Persuasion (CHA) check to negotiate a discount with the shop owner. 3 attempts per shop per in-game day. DC escalates with each failure, and a critical fail (miss by 10+) damages reputation with the NPC. On success, the item is purchased automatically at the discounted price — coins are deducted from the character and credited to the shop treasury.

    Mechanic Detail
    DC formula 10 + discount%/5 + fail_streak×2 − standing/20
    Success Pays price × (100 − discount%) / 100
    Failure fail_streak++, 1 attempt burned, DC rises
    Critical fail (by ≥ 10) Standing with NPC reduced by 1d4
    3 failures NPC refuses further haggling for the day
    Standing bonus Every +20 standing reduces DC by 1

    Example: ttrpg-engine shop haggle 1 3 2 1 20 — character #3 tries for 20% off item #2 at shop #1.

Actions (enforce action economy)

The engine enforces 5e action economy: one action (with Extra Attack / Multiattack), one bonus action, one reaction per round. The attacks_used counter is compared against multiattack_count (creatures/NPCs, default 1; characters default 1 — increase via combat use-feature for Extra Attack).

### 20. Time, Calendar & Decay

A unified time progression system with a 360-day Forgotten Realms calendar. All reputation and
standing values decay over time toward zero (14-day half-life), encouraging characters to
maintain relationships.

**Calendar model:** `total_elapsed_hours` is the single source of truth — 7 fields derive from it:

| Field | Derivation |
|---|---|
| `in_game_hour` | `total_hours % 24` |
| `in_game_day_of_month` | `(total_hours / 24) % 30 + 1` |
| `in_game_month` | `(total_hours / 720) % 12 + 1` |
| `in_game_year` | `1492 + total_hours / 8640` |
| `in_game_day` | `total_hours / 24` |
| `in_game_time` | hour 6-11=morning, 12-17=afternoon, 18-21=evening, else=night |
| `current_season` | month 1-3=winter, 4-6=spring, 7-9=summer, 10-12=autumn |

  • Rest Auto-Advance: Short rests automatically advance the clock by 1 hour. Long rests advance by 8 hours. No separate command needed — the rest commands handle it.

Unified decay applies to all reputation systems:

System Decay trigger Display
Faction standings faction set-standing touches timestamp faction get-standing shows raw + decayed
Character↔NPC standings npc set-char-standing and shop haggle touch timestamp Decay computed at query time
NPC↔NPC relationships npc set-relationship touches timestamp can-enter access checks use decayed score
Wanted heat wanted crime and wanted set touch timestamp wanted get and wanted list show decayed heat

Decay formula: standing × e^(-0.05 × days_elapsed) — half-life of ~14 days. After 30 days without interaction, standing drops to ~22% of its original value.

Wanted heat decay uses the same exponential curve, calculated per-hour: heat × e^(-0.05/24 × hours_elapsed). The finer granularity prevents edge cases on day 0 (the first day of a campaign).

21. Wanted & Crime System

Track criminal heat per character/NPC, per faction (jurisdiction), per location. Wanted levels decay over time, inherit through the location hierarchy, and map to 0–5 narrative tiers the AI DM uses to describe guard behavior.

Design. The system answers one question: "Who is wanted, where, by whom, and for what?" It was built as a world-consistency harness — the AI DM queries it to ground its narrative in canonical state rather than hallucinating jurisdictional boundaries across sessions.

Core concepts

Concept Description
Heat points Internal simulation value (0–100+). Crimes add heat; time decays it.
Tier AI-facing narrative level (0–5), derived from heat. Each tier has a label and guard behavior.
Jurisdiction A faction that enforces law (e.g. "Waterdeep Watch", "Thieves' Guild"). Heat is per-faction — you can be Hunted by the Watch but Protected by the Guild.
Location Where the crime happened. Wanted levels propagate up the location tree — being wanted in a child location inherits from the parent unless explicitly overridden.
Crime log Immutable audit trail of every crime: who did what, where, when, and how much heat it added.

Tier mapping

Heat Tier Label Guard behavior
0 0 Clean Ignore
1–15 1 Suspicious Question
16–35 2 Wanted Detain
36–60 3 Hunted Attack on sight
61–85 4 Infamous Mobilize guards
86+ 5 Legendary Fugitive Scry & strike

Location inheritance

When you query wanted get for a specific location, the engine walks the parent_id chain upward:

  1. Check for an explicit wanted_heat row at the requested location
  2. If none found, check the parent location
  3. Continue until a row is found or the root is reached

An explicit row at a child location takes precedence over the parent — this is the opt-out mechanism. A character wanted at Heat 3 in Waterdeep can be explicitly set to Heat 0 (Clean) in the Dock Ward (e.g., "Thieves' Guild protection"), and wanted get for the Dock Ward will return Clean.

Decay

Wanted heat decays exponentially with the same ~14-day half-life as faction standings. The decay is computed at query time from the last_decay_hour timestamp (stored as total_elapsed_hours) and never persisted back — the raw heat remains unchanged, only the displayed value decays. Setting heat via crime or set resets the decay timer.

Actors without a campaign assignment can still accumulate wanted heat (decay timer is 0, meaning "never decays"). Assign the actor to a campaign and advance time to enable decay.

Automatic Database Schema Migrations

The tool handles schema updates automatically using SQLite's internal versioning integer PRAGMA user_version.

When the CLI starts up, it reads the current schema version of ttrpg-engine.db. If the database is new or has an older version, the tool executes all missing forward-only SQL migration blocks sequentially and stamps the new version number onto the file. This requires zero setup or manual commands from the Dungeon Master, keeping campaign data intact.
